Autonomous expertise firm Argo AI stated it laid off about 150 staff on Thursday.
In a written assertion, an Argo spokesman stated the layoffs have been a part of “prudent changes to our marketing strategy” as the corporate deliberate for future development.
Former Argo staff who labored within the firm’s human assets, recruiting, technical sourcing and communications divisions shared information of their layoffs on their respective LinkedIn profiles.
Argo’s workforce stays at greater than 2,000 staff worldwide, in accordance with the spokesperson.
The Pittsburgh-based firm has been constructing and launching new operations at a speedy tempo over the previous yr.
In September, it started a partnership with Walmart that centered on supply providers in Miami, Washington, DC, and Austin, Texas. That got here the identical month that Argo started autonomous exams in Munich.
In December, Argo partnered with Lyft and Ford to launch the ride-sharing service in Miami, a metropolis that has been on the forefront of the corporate’s total AV efforts for years. Two months in the past, Argo started testing autonomous autos with out human security drivers on the wheel in Miami.
The layoffs wouldn’t hamper the expansion of these partnerships, the Argo spokesman stated, nor would they delay any of the corporate’s plans to develop industrial providers round its self-driving methods.
Ford Motor Co. and Volkswagen Group are the principle traders in Argo.
